    The Rise of Pickleball: Why It's Gaining Popularity

    Pickleball, a sport that combines elements of tennis, badminton, and table tennis, has surged in popularity over the past few years. Known for its simplistic rules and engaging gameplay, it has caught the attention of diverse age groups across various regions. This fusion sport, often played on a badminton-sized court with a paddle and a plastic ball, is celebrated for its easy learning curve, social nature, and health benefits.

    Accessible for All Ages and Skill Levels

    One of the main attractions of pickleball is its accessibility. Whether you are a 10-year-old beginner or a 70-year-old looking to remain active, pickleball offers something for everyone. The game’s design allows for a lower-impact sport compared to traditional racket sports, making it particularly appealing to seniors seeking physical activity without the stress on joints.

    Easy to Learn, Hard to Master

    Pickleball’s rules are straightforward, allowing newcomers to pick up the essentials rapidly. This easy entry into the sport makes it less intimidating and more approachable for beginners. However, as with many sports, mastering pickleball requires skill and strategy, ensuring it remains challenging and competitive for more seasoned players.

    The Social Aspect

    Another reason for pickleball’s popularity is its ability to foster social interaction. Most pickleball games are played in doubles, which requires teamwork and communication. The sport often carries a community vibe, with local clubs and groups hosting regular matches, leagues, and social gatherings. The small court and slower pace of the ball compared to tennis mean players can engage in conversation and camaraderie without sacrificing competitive intensity.

    Health Benefits

    Apart from its social benefits, pickleball also provides excellent physical exercise. It enhances cardiovascular health, improves coordination and balance, and promotes weight loss. The game’s dynamic movements help enhance agility and reflexes while providing a significant workout that is both fun and stimulating.

    The Pandemic Factor

    The COVID-19 pandemic played a substantial role in accelerating pickleball's popularity. With social distancing guidelines restricting many indoor activities, pickleball offered an outdoor, socially engaging sport that naturally maintained safe distancing due to its court size and play style. As people searched for hobbies and ways to stay fit during lockdowns, many discovered pickleball as an ideal solution.

    A Growing Community

    The sport’s community-friendly nature has encouraged organizations to develop facilities and clubs to support its growth. New pickleball courts are cropping up in neighborhoods throughout the U.S., Canada, and beyond, making it more accessible to prospective players. Local pickleball clubs are frequently forming, hosting beginner workshops, tournaments, and community events, enriching local social structures.

    Technological Influence

    Technology has also played a part in propelling pickleball forward. Instructional videos, forums, and online communities have helped enthusiasts of all levels refine their skills and tactics. This surge of online resources has created a comprehensive environment for learning and skill development, inviting more people to join the pickleball movement.
